Berlin has a violent crime rate of 196 per 100,000 residents, 49% below the national average of 380. This breaks down to aggravated assault at 146.8 per 100,000, robbery at 0.0, rape at 48.9. The murder rate is 0.0 per 100,000 (below the national rate of 6.3). Property crime stands at 587 per 100,000, 70% below the U.S. average. This includes larceny/theft at 538, burglary at 49, vehicle theft at 0 per 100,000 residents. The county recorded 8 fatal traffic crashes. Overall, Berlin receives a safety grade of F.
